3 children have a total of $2190.
Adam has $480 more than Charlie.
Charlie has 4 times as much as Bryan.
- How much does Adam have?
- How much does Charlie have?
- How much does Bryan have?
(a)
Choose the person with least money to be 1 u.
Amount that Bryan has = 1 u
Amount that Charlie has = 4 u
Amount that Adam has = 4 u + 480
Total amount that Adam, Charlie and Bryan
= 1 u + 4 u + 4 u + 480
= 9 u + 480
9 u + 480 = 2190
9 u = 2190 - 480 = 1710
9 u = 1710
1 u = 1710 ÷ 9 = 190
Amount that Adam has
= 4 u + 480
= 4 x 190 + 480
= 760 + 480
= $1240
(b)
Amount that Charlie has
= 4 u
= $760
(c)
Amount that Bryan has
= 1 u
= $190
Answer(s): (a) $1240; (b) $760; (c) $190
